Solitary crystals of metals are smooth and malleable, when polycrystalline metals are harder and stronger and are more valuable industrially. Most polycrystalline components could be made into large single crystals just after prolonged heat cure. Previously blacksmiths would heat a piece of metallic to make it malleable: warmth helps make a number of grains increase huge by incorporating smaller sized types. The smiths here would bend the softened steel into shape after which pound it awhile; the pounding would allow it to be polycrystalline once again, escalating its toughness.
水晶形成后由于外力作用或某种人为原因使水晶产生大的裂隙或裂纹,这种裂纹有大有小,对水晶的影响也有大小之分。
在透明的水晶中,隐裂纹呈亮晶晶的片状,有时还会有晕彩效应。这些裂纹是水晶在生长过程中,遇到外力挤压而在内部产生的一些隐形裂纹,隐裂纹在芙蓉石、紫水晶、白水晶球及白水晶柱中都很常见。有的裂纹后来被物质填充,形成愈合的裂纹,也就是原来的裂纹又长住了。这种裂纹对水晶的影响相对要小一些。
